(Meth)-acrylic acid derivatives of tricyclodecanes of the formula <IMAGE> in which R1 and R2 are identical or different and denote hydrogen, lower alkyl, lower alkoxy, halogen or trifluoromethyl and R3 and R4 are identical or different and represent the group <IMAGE> wherein X denotes a divalent bridge member from the group <IMAGE> and Y denotes a divalent bridge member from the group <IMAGE> +TR <IMAGE> and wherein R5 represents hydrogen or methyl and R6 represents lower alkyl or phenyl, have been found. Dental compositions in which the present (meth)-acrylic acid derivatives of tricyclodecanes are used, exhibit considerably less polymerization shrinkage. |
